Understanding the Various Sorts Of Geyser
While there are different kinds of geysers available on the market, understanding the distinctions in between them is essential for energy efficiency (geyser sizes). The very first type, storage space hot springs, are one of the most common and store warm water in a storage tank for usage when needed. They are readily available in various capacities and are normally energy-efficient, however they can lose warmth when not being used
The second type is the tankless geyser, which heats water on need, causing much less energy waste yet calling for a greater preliminary power draw. There are warmth pump geysers that make use of electrical energy to move warmth from one location to an additional instead of producing warm directly. They can be two to three times much more power reliable than conventional storage hot springs. Finally, solar hot springs use solar power to heat up the water, making them one of the most energy-efficient but likewise the most pricey.
Evaluating Your Home's Hot Water Needs
Prior to diving right into the purchase of a hot spring, it is critical to analyze the hot water requirements of your home. This assessment must consider countless elements including the number of home members, frequency of hot water usage, and the variety of hot water outlets in the home (geyser sizes). A little family with seldom warm water usage may require a smaller, much less effective geyser compared to a larger family with several daily warm water needs
The sort of home appliances that require warm water additionally play a substantial function. Dishwashers and washing equipments, for instance, might require more warm water than a basic shower or cooking area sink. Particular tasks such as showering or cleansing additionally affect the regularity and quantity of hot water required.

Considerations in Geyser Size and Placement
Beyond energy performance scores, the dimension and positioning of your geyser are crucial components to consider. The size of the geyser should straighten with your home's warm water requirements. A tiny geyser might use much less energy yet may not supply sufficient hot water for numerous usages at the exact same time, whereas a bigger system can satisfy greater demand however might take in more power.
Positioning additionally influences power effectiveness. Geysers need to be installed close to factors of usage to reduce warm loss during water transport. A centrally situated geyser can service multiple locations effectively. In addition, taking into consideration thermal insulation, a geyser situated in a warmer area sheds much less heat and consequently makes use of much less energy to maintain the water temperature level.
